#0d2714 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0d2714 is composed of 5.1% red, 15.3%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 48.7% yellow and 84.7% black. It has a hue angle of 136.2 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 10.2%. #0d2714 color hex could be obtained by blending #1a4e28 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

Shades and Tints of #0d2714
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030a05 is the darkest color, while #fafdfb is the lightest one.
